References & Further Reading

References

  1. D. Tse and P. Viswanath, Fundamentals of Wireless Communication, Cambridge University Press, 2005

    Rigorous treatment of MIMO capacity, detection, and the diversity-multiplexing trade-off.

  2. E. Bjornson, J. Hoydis, and L. Sanguinetti, Massive MIMO Networks: Spectral, Energy, and Hardware Efficiency, Now Publishers, 2017

    The definitive reference on massive MIMO theory and simulation.

  3. G. J. Foschini and M. J. Gans, On Limits of Wireless Communications in a Fading Environment, Wireless Personal Commun., 1998

    Introduces V-BLAST and spatial multiplexing concepts.

  4. E. Viterbo and J. Boutros, A Universal Lattice Code Decoder for Fading Channels, IEEE Trans. IT, 1999

    Introduces sphere decoding for MIMO communications.

  5. E. Telatar, Capacity of Multi-Antenna Gaussian Channels, European Trans. Telecomm., 1999

    The foundational paper deriving MIMO capacity.

Further Reading

  • Lattice reduction-aided detection

    D. Wubben et al., 'Lattice Reduction,' IEEE Signal Proc. Mag., 2011

    Near-ML performance with polynomial complexity using LLL algorithm.

  • Massive MIMO with imperfect CSI

    H. Q. Ngo et al., 'Energy and Spectral Efficiency of Very Large Multiuser MIMO Systems,' IEEE Trans. Commun., 2013

    Practical analysis of massive MIMO with pilot-based channel estimation.

  • Deep learning for MIMO detection

    N. Samuel et al., 'Learning to Detect,' IEEE Trans. SP, 2019

    Neural network-based MIMO detectors approaching ML performance.
